Summit High School (Fontana, California)
Summit High School in Fontana, California, is one of five comprehensive high schools in the Fontana Unified School District. It is located at 15551 Summit Avenue. The Summit Branch Public Library is located on the school campus. The school was opened on September 5, 2006. Demographics In 2013, enrollment was 2,554 students from diversified backgrounds: 70.7% Hispanic or Latino, 13.5% African American, 8.3% White, 4.2% Filipino, 2.2% Asian, 0.2% American Indian, 0.2% Pacific Islander and 0.7% other ethnic backgrounds. School motto The school mission statement is "''We Can't Spell Summit Without U!''" American football team Summit High School is known for its American football program, which has found success in the Sunkist League. In the 2011–12 season, Summit won the CIF-SS championship and was ranked 37th in the state of California. Fontana, California
Fontana is a city in San Bernardino County, California. Founded by Azariel Blanchard Miller in 1913, it remained essentially rural until World War II, when entrepreneur Henry J. Kaiser built a large steel mill in the area. It is now a regional hub of the trucking industry, with the east–west Interstate 10 and State Route 210 crossing the city and Interstate 15 passing diagonally through its northwestern quadrant. The city is about 46 miles east of Los Angeles. It is home to a renovated historic theater, a municipal park, and the Auto Club Speedway, which is on the site of the old Kaiser Steel Mill just outside the city. Fontana Unified School District
Fontana Unified School District is located in and serves most of the city of Fontana, California, a community in San Bernardino County about 50 miles east of Los Angeles. The district contains 45 schools, which serve students from K-12 to adult education. It was established in the 1920s and unified in 1956. At the December 14, 2016 Board Meeting, the Board of Education appointed Randal S. Bassett as Superintendent. Board of Education Board of Education provides direction for operating the District through actions taken at its meetings. Board members, as a body, develop the policies by which the educational programs and other business of the District are carried out. California Interscholastic Federation
The California Interscholastic Federation (CIF) is the governing body for high school sports in the U.S. state of California. CIF membership includes both public and private high schools. Unlike most other state organizations, it does not have a single, statewide championships for all sports; instead, for some sports, the CIF's 10 Sections each have their own championships. Six schools near the state border are members of adjacent state's associations. San Pasqual Valley High School is part of the Arizona Interscholastic Association. Coleville High School, Needles High School, North Tahoe High School, South Tahoe High School and Truckee High School are part of the Nevada Interscholastic Activities Association. History As early as 1891, schools around the San Francisco Bay Area began competing against each other in football organized by the Amateur Academic Athletic Association. CIF Southern Section
The California Interscholastic Federation-Southern Section (CIF-SS) is the governing body for high school athletics in most of Southern California and is the largest of the ten sections that comprise the California Interscholastic Federation (CIF). Its membership includes most public and private high schools in Orange, Los Angeles, Riverside, San Bernardino, Ventura, and central and southern Santa Barbara counties. At the start of the 2018/9 season, 13 schools from San Luis Obispo County and northern Santa Barbara County left the Southern Section to join the much smaller CIF Central Section. Teams from the Los Angeles Unified School District (LAUSD) and surrounding areas have competed in the CIF Los Angeles City Section since 1935. CIFSS's offices are located in Los Alamitos. Founded in 1913, the CIF Southern Section includes over 565 member public and private high schools and is by far the largest CIF section. Sunkist League
The Sunkist League is a high school athletic league that is part of the CIF Southern Section. Members are located in western San Bernardino County. The Sunkist League is now a part of the Arrowhead Athletic Conference. The conference has 3 leagues, San Andreas League, Sunkist League, and Skyline League. All 15 schools for boys and girls sports can move freely through the 3 leagues through means of competitive balance. The Arrowhead Athletic Conference was initially founded with schools that included the San Andreas League, the Sunkist League, and Wilmer Amina Carter High School during the 2020-2021 school year. Notre Dame High School was later added for the 2022-2023 school year from the Raincross Conference. Jillian Alleyne
Jillian Alleyne is an American professional basketball player who is currently a free agent in the Women's National Basketball Association (WNBA). She played college basketball for University of Oregon. High school Alleyne graduated from Summit High School in Fontana, California, in 2012. She was a McDonald's All-American nominee, named Sunkist League MVP, an all-state selection, and Inland Valley Player of the Year. Awards and honors She recorded 21 consecutive double-doubles in an NCAA game, the third most in NCAA women's basketball history. She averaged 19.6 points per game and 16.3 rebounds per game during the 21 games. Alleyne shared the media version of the Pac-12 Player of the Year award in 2016 with Oregon State's Jamie Weisner, who had also won the Pac-12 coaches' version of the award. Jamaal Williams
Jamaal Malik Williams (born April 3, 1995) is an American football running back for the Detroit Lions of the National Football League (NFL). He played college football at BYU and was drafted by the Green Bay Packers in the fourth round of the 2017 NFL Draft. Early years Williams attended Summit High School in Fontana, California. While there, he played high school football for the Sky Hawks. A 3-star recruit, he committed to Brigham Young University (BYU) to play college football over an offer from Boise State. College career Williams played at BYU from 2012 to 2016. 2012 season On August 30, 2012, Williams made his collegiate debut with 15 rushing yards in the win over Washington State. On September 15, against Utah, he had his first collegiate rushing touchdown. On September 28, against Hawaii, he had 155 rushing yards and two rushing touchdowns. Donte Deayon
Donte Deayon (born January 28, 1994) is a former American football cornerback. He played college football at Boise State, and was signed by the New York Giants as an undrafted free agent in 2016 before signing with the Los Angeles Rams in 2018. College career Deayon played college football for the Boise State Broncos, as a 150-pound cornerback. He was named to the All-Mountain West Second-team for three straight seasons. Professional career New York Giants Deayon signed with the New York Giants as an undrafted free agent on May 6, 2016. He was waived on September 3, 2016, and was signed to the practice squad the next day. He was released on October 13, 2016. He signed a reserve/future contract with the Giants on January 9, 2017. On September 2, 2017, Deayon was waived by the Giants and was signed to the practice squad the next day. He was promoted to the active roster on October 12, 2017. Jalin Turner
Jalin Turner (born 18 May 1995) is an American mixed martial artist who currently competes in the lightweight division of the UFC. A professional since 2016, he has also competed for Bellator MMA, the World Series of Fighting, King of the Cage, and Tachi Palace Fights. As of October 24, 2022, he is #10 in the UFC lightweight rankings. Background Born in San Bernardino, California, Turner went on to attend Summit High School, where he was unable to play much sports such as football, basketball or track and field due to multiple injuries. Having the most talent in wrestling, Turner took up the sport during the pre–season of his sophomore year, but was unable to compete that season due to a broken finger. Frustrated by the recurring injuries, he started watching MMA bouts on television, which inspired him to try and practice the sport.
